Customers are saying

Customers have good things to say about the vívoactive Smartwatch's long battery life, waterproof capabilities, and accurate activity tracking. Many users also appreciate its multi-sport functions, user-friendly interface, and stylish design. However, some users have expressed concerns about the display being a bit dark in low light conditions, connectivity issues, and the lack of a heart rate monitor.

    Long battery life. Large screen. This watch is good for multiple sports. It also connects via bluetooth to my phone to advise me of incoming calls and texts. In order to use the golf gps you must download to your phone the specific course you intend to play. This can be a bit of a bother if you play multiple courses.

    I bought mainly because of GPS as I did not want to rely on my smartphone. Excellent choice, definitely worth the price: accuracy is guaranteed but remember to fully charge your watch before starting your GPS-tracked activity. Without GPS the battery duration is slightly less than one week.
